2010-06-03 Jb Evain <jbevain@novell.com>
[mcs.git] / ilasm / tests / invalid-field.il
blobf2f16ace0503bb5bc72a528ecd1814b80cc47f50
1 // Test for ref to an non-existant field
3 .assembly extern mscorlib
5   .ver 1:0:5000:0
7 .assembly 'invalid-field'
11   .class private auto ansi beforefieldinit test
12         extends [mscorlib]System.Object
13   {
14     .method public hidebysig  specialname  rtspecialname 
15            instance default void .ctor ()  cil managed 
16     {
17         .maxstack 8
18         IL_0000:  ldarg.0 
19         IL_0001:  call instance void object::.ctor()
20         IL_0006:  ret 
21     }
23     .method public hidebysig 
24            instance default void foo ()  cil managed 
25     {
26         .maxstack 8
27         IL_0000:  ldarg.0 
28         IL_0001:  ldc.i4.5 
29         IL_0002:  stfld  int32 test::invalid
30         IL_0007:  ret 
31     }
33   }